Empty and Throw Away

Silica is made from an inert, non-toxic substance that can absorb water. The packets are a choking hazard for children and pets, and dangerous in high quantities. Tear packets open, empty its silica into the garbage, then toss out the empty packet as well.

Use as Drying Agent

Put silica packets in places where moisture is unwelcome, from vehicle dashboards to mold-prone corners of your home. Store them with household items at risk for mold or water damage, or use them to dry out water-damaged electronics.
